Andrew Bradshaw
United Kingdom
British poker player, world ranking 5902, total winnings $552,519. Participates in both online and live events, but public information is limited.
Player Overview
Andrew Bradshaw, a British poker player, currently ranked 5902nd in the world, with career earnings of $552,519. His poker career is primarily online, with few publicly recorded live results.
Career and Major Achievements
Andrew Bradshaw's poker career is mostly online, having cashed in numerous online tournaments, accumulating over $550,000 in prize money. Regarding live events, there are no publicly known major final table appearances.
